Plasma and intracellular kinetics of lithium after oral administration of various lithium salts.

作者信息

Altamura A C, Gomeni R, Sacchetti E, Smeraldi E

出版信息

Eur J Clin Pharmacol. 1977 Aug 17;12(1):59-63. doi: 10.1007/BF00561406.

DOI:10.1007/BF00561406
PMID:902676
Abstract

Five healthy volunteers were treated orally with lithium carbonate, sulphate, or chloride. There were no significant differences in area under time-concentration curves, half-lives, total body clearance or apparent distribution volumes between the various salts, either in plasma or in the RBC compartment. The carbonate salt did show a higher RBC/plasma distribution ratio than the other salts, which might possibly imply greater therapeutic effectiveness of this salt. Some considerations on the tolerability of various lithium salts are discussed.
